Guggenheim Raises PT After Actavis (ACT) Has 1Q15 EPS Beat
May 11, 2015 10:57 AM EDTGuggenheim reiterates their Buy rating on Actavis (NYSE: ACT), and raised the price target to $355.00 (from $345.00), following a 1Q15 beat. ACT reported an adjusted 1Q15 diluted EPS of $4.30. This came $0.34 higher than consensus, and $0.41 better than Guggenheim estimates.
